Al-Salam City in Umm Al-Quwain

Tameer Holding, of which half of its stock is owned by the Saudi Al-Rajhi group and the rest by Saudi and Gulf investors, recently announced the launch of its latest, largest project - the Al-Salam City in Umm Al-Quwain. According to Arab News, the project is expected to cost over AED30 billion and will be built over an area covering 220 million square meters.

 

The Al-Salam City is an integrated residential & commercial city, consisting of a number of residential districts. The development will house over half a million residents and will include a number of prominent towers.

 

The first phase of the Project will include the development of the infrastructure of the whole city, including the "Down Town" area. It will also include a main hotel tower composed of more than 50 floors, apart from 20 residential and commercial towers of 20 to 25 floors. The first phase will also realise the development of residential districts, where the first district will include 1000 residential villas while the second will compose of 200 buildings of 5 to 10 floors.
